Timmy's Terrific Team hand Spoiler third straight loss in 130.80-92.82 runaway

Timmy's Terrific Team rolled to a 130.80-92.82 victory to hand Spoiler their third straight loss. Timmy's Terrific Team nabbed a 24.20-point lead on Thursday behind Patrick Mahomes (30.6 points) and never gave it back. Aaron Rodgers (23.82 points) and Dalton Schultz (16.7) did everything they could for Spoiler in the loss. This marks the first time this season Timmy's Terrific Team have beaten Spoiler, after falling 167.2-114.18 in their last matchup. Timmy's Terrific Team ends the season on a high note, but they'll miss the postseason with a record of 5-10. Spoiler will also be home for the playoffs, finishing at 3-12.
